Using Distress Inks and Gold Color Shine I created a sheet of colorful paper, which I then die cut using the Fall Leaves 8 dies by Cheery Lynn.

I stamped portions of the leaves and acorn images in each corner
framing in my larger image.  Backed the main image with Vellum to create a faux window.  Colored my flowers in a Fall palette.

I used the Hexagon Cover Plate and Counting My Blessings dies from Papertrey Ink.  I layered the thankful teal on black, so it pops a bit more.  Swiss Dots Embossing Folder on inside grey strip for texture. 


The image is colored with Copic Markers and is by Penny Black, Blooming Gardens.  MFT Cross Stitched Tags die set.  Crystal Drops in Ebony and Black and White Gingham Ribbon as accents. 
 
I stamped the poppy petals twice and fussy cut one out.  Using 3D dots I popped them up to add some dimension.   


I also added some Yellow Stickles to the poppies.

I had fun with this card, so nice to use fresh bright colors......Christmas was so last year lol.  I used the Papertrey Ink stamp and dies set, Flower Favorites (butterflies), stamp set, Daydreamer (colorful dots) and the Swoosh die (word die cuts). 
 
 
 
 
I cut out the butterflies completely, stamped the images and then colored a bit deeper color outlining the butterflies (kind of hard to see).  I then added a crease and mounted them on the negative space of the card stock, lined with black card stock underneath.....they kind of POP a bit more like this!  I also added a bit of Wink Of Stellar Clear to the single yellow dots.

I used the beautiful C31 Pine Cone Sprig stamp from Great Impressions.  Stamping it 3 times on to a Spellbinders Rectangle die and coloring it with Copic Markers.  I then splattered it using Gold Craft Paint and my trusty old toothbrush.....love that!  Added white dots to the holly berries using a Sakura White Glaze Pen.

 
And lastly, topped it off with a thanks die cut and green burlap ribbon tab.
